A slender whiptail catfish from the blackwater coastal drainages of Suriname and the adjacent Guianas, Loricaria nickeriensis is one of only a handful of Loricaria species with a Near Threatened IUCN rating — a flag on its restricted range rather than evidence of population collapse. In the aquarium it is a patient, undemanding fish that rewards a well-planted, low-flow tank with its quietly elegant, armour-plated silhouette.

What's in the name

Loricaria nickeriensislor-ih-KAIR-ee-uh nick-er-ee-EN-sis

Loricaria
  • loricaLatina cuirass or corslet of leather — a suit of armour, alluding to the bony scute armour of the fish
  • -ariaLatinadjectival suffix denoting 'pertaining to' or 'bearing'
nickeriensis
  • NickerieToponym (Suriname)the Nickerie District of Suriname, locality of the type specimens
  • -ensisLatinsuffix denoting 'from' or 'of' a place

Taxonomy & naming

Loricaria nickeriensis was formally described by Isbrücker in 1979, in the Revue française d'Aquariologie Herpétologie (volume 5, number 4 [for 1978], pp. 97, Figs. 11–13). The type specimens were collected from the Fallawatra River, approximately 5 kilometres south-southwest of Stondansie falls, Nickerie District, Suriname — the locality that provides the species epithet.

The Catalog of Fishes (Eschmeyer, CAS) recognises Loricaria nickeriensis as a valid species with no published synonyms. The genus Loricaria Linnaeus, 1758 is one of the founding genera of the family Loricariidae and lends its name to the subfamily Loricariinae — the whiptail loricariids. Within the subfamily, Loricaria sensu stricto is distinguished from the superficially similar Rineloricaria by the structure of the mouth: Loricaria adults develop a more elaborate, feathered sucker disc with enlarged oral papillae, a feature most obvious when comparing live adults side by side. No L-number or aquarium trade code has been assigned to this species.

Isbrücker's 1979 paper was a major systematic contribution that simultaneously described several new Loricaria species, clarifying the boundaries of a genus that had accumulated considerable taxonomic confusion since the eighteenth century. Loricaria nickeriensis is one of several coastal Guiana endemics he formalised in that work.

Morphology

Like all Loricaria, L. nickeriensis is dorsoventrally flattened — a body plan refined over millions of years for life pressed against the substrate. The head is broad and depressed, the snout rounded when seen from above, and the ventral mouth forms a sucking disc fringed with fine papillae. Body armour consists of overlapping keeled bony scutes arranged in longitudinal rows; the lateral line scutes bear low, posteriorly directed spines that give the flanks a slightly rough, file-like texture.

Adults reach approximately 4.5 in standard length (SL). Coloration follows the typical Loricaria pattern: a warm brown to tan ground colour with a faint network of darker mottling, giving a cryptic, sand-and-leaf-litter appearance ideally suited to the shallow, tannin-stained streams of the Guiana lowlands. The caudal fin is elongated and somewhat lanceolate, with the upper lobe drawn out into a filament in many specimens — a characteristic shared across the genus.

Sexual dimorphism has not been specifically described in the literature for this species, but the genus-level pattern is well documented: males typically develop a broader head, hypertrophied interopercular odontodes (cheek bristles) during breeding condition, and a slimmer body profile than gravid females. Females in breeding condition are visibly deeper-bodied when viewed from the side.

Habitat

Loricaria nickeriensis is known from the Nickerie and Marowijne river basins of Suriname and extends into the coastal drainages of adjacent French Guiana and Guyana. These are lowland systems draining the Guiana Shield — typically shallow, slow-moving rivers and streams flowing across a coastal plain vegetated with tropical forest and gallery woodland.

Water chemistry in this region tends toward the acidic and soft: FishBase records a pH range of 6.2–7.2 and temperatures of 68–75 °F for this species, consistent with the blackwater and clearwater character of many Guiana coastal rivers. Conductivity is generally low. The species is noted as demersal and freshwater, favouring the fine substrates — sand, silt, leaf litter, and decaying wood — of shallow river margins and backwaters where current is gentle.

Loricaria species are facultative air-breathers, able to supplement gill respiration with atmospheric air when dissolved oxygen falls — an adaptation that may be particularly useful in warm, organically enriched backwaters and flooded forest. The trophic level of 2.6 (±0.2) recorded by FishBase indicates a diet composed primarily of small organisms and organic material at or near the substrate surface.

Feeding

In the wild, L. nickeriensis likely feeds by grazing algae, biofilm, fine organic detritus, and small invertebrates from the substrate surface — the typical diet of a demersal loricariid with a trophic level around 2.6. The sucking disc mouth is adapted for scraping fine material from hard and soft surfaces alike, including submerged leaves, roots, and compacted sediment.

In the aquarium, the species should be offered a varied diet weighted toward vegetable matter and sinking foods: algae wafers, spirulina-based sinking pellets, and occasional blanched vegetables (courgette, cucumber, peas, spinach) are all appropriate. Sinking carnivore pellets, frozen bloodworm, and small frozen crustaceans can supplement the diet to provide animal protein. Live or frozen foods are particularly useful for conditioning fish in preparation for breeding attempts. Feed after lights-out, as this is primarily a crepuscular to nocturnal feeder.

Mating

No breeding reports for Loricaria nickeriensis appear in the hobbyist literature or in the PlanetCatfish database as of 2026. General Loricaria biology, however, provides a plausible framework. Males in breeding condition are characterised by more pronounced interopercular odontodes and a slimmer body profile relative to females, which become noticeably gravid as they ripen.

Male territorial behaviour around preferred spawning sites — shallow depressions, flat rock surfaces, or broad leaves — is typical of the genus. In some Loricaria species the male attaches the egg mass to a flat surface and carries or fans the eggs rather than guarding them in a fixed site; the degree to which this applies to L. nickeriensis specifically is not documented. Soft, acidic water with gentle flow and low light are the conditions most likely to encourage any loricariine to display courtship behaviour in captivity.

Breeding

No captive breeding records for Loricaria nickeriensis have been published or reported on PlanetCatfish as of the writing of this article — data sparse. What is established for Loricaria as a genus is that these are substrate spawners: eggs are deposited on a firm surface (flat rock, broad leaf, or compacted substrate), and the male guards the clutch, fanning with his fins to maintain oxygen flow and removing infertile eggs.

Some Loricaria species are notable for a form of paternal egg-carrying, in which the male presses the egg mass against his lower lip and ventral surface and physically moves with it — a behaviour observed in Loricaria cataphracta and related taxa. Whether L. nickeriensis shares this behaviour is undocumented. Any hobbyist who successfully breeds this species would be contributing genuinely novel information to the literature on the group.

In the aquarium

Loricaria nickeriensis is an uncommonly encountered whiptail in the hobby, rarely exported and without an L-number designation to drive collector interest. For the specialist keeper who obtains specimens, the requirements are consistent with other soft-water Guiana whiptails.

A tank of 20 US gal or more is appropriate for a pair or small group; a fine sand substrate is strongly preferred, as these fish rest and partly bury themselves in the substrate. Smooth, rounded décor — driftwood, flat stones, and dried leaves — provides resting sites and feeding surfaces. Strong current is not required; gentle flow with thorough filtration is better suited to the slow-moving waters this species inhabits.

Water chemistry should reflect the Guiana coastal lowlands: temperature 68–75 °F, pH 6.2–7.2, low to moderate hardness. Slightly acidic, tannin-stained water (from Indian almond leaves, alder cones, or a small peat filter) is beneficial and may improve colour and willingness to feed. Avoid strong lighting; shaded tanks with floating plants are ideal.

The species is peaceful and should not be mixed with aggressive bottom-dwellers. Small, calm mid-water fish (tetras, small rasboras, pencilfish) make ideal companions. Standard whiptail husbandry applies: clean water, varied diet, low nitrates, and minimal disturbance.

Conservation

The IUCN Red List assessed Loricaria nickeriensis as Near Threatened (NT) on 14 January 2021 — a notable distinction, as most freshwater fish in the Guiana Shield receive Least Concern ratings. The NT status reflects the species' restricted extent of occurrence: it is known only from the Nickerie and Marowijne river basins of Suriname and adjacent Guyanese coastal drainages, a relatively small geographic footprint. No major acute threats are currently quantified, but the combination of a limited range and the general susceptibility of lowland coastal river systems to habitat modification justifies caution.

The coastal rivers of Suriname face growing pressure from agricultural expansion, gold mining activities (particularly mercury contamination from artisanal gold mining in the interior), forestry, and infrastructure development. These threats, while not yet documented to have caused measurable declines in L. nickeriensis populations, represent plausible drivers of future deterioration in water quality and habitat integrity within its range. The species is not commercially targeted for the ornamental trade in any significant quantity, reducing that particular pressure. Continued monitoring of the Nickerie and Marowijne basins is warranted given the restricted range.
